The focus of this blog is to prepare my fitness for undertaking Ben Nevis. My current fitness isn't horrific, but it's not great either. I walk my dog every day for over an hour, plus some Pilates and kettlebell exercises.


However, in terms of From Sofa to Summit training, I have implemented one main goal for week 1...consistent steps. I have a Fitbit Inspire that I use to count my steps. The increase in steps is at the heart of the training over the next 40 weeks. There will be further additions along the way, like adding a backpack, stairs, etc, but the focus is on step count. We will aim to hit 75,000 steps in one day prior to climbing old Benny!

Week One fitness implementation:


Goal of 8000 steps minimum per day - with Tuesday and Thursday increasing to 10,000 steps, minimum. 


Walk around your kitchen, park further away from Morrisons entrance, walk the dog an extra 10mins.  It all adds up. Anyone else got any tips? Comment below x
